Speech Debelle: “Sunday Dinner On A Monday” (Review & Stream)

Food plays an important role in the life of Corynne Elliot aka Speech Debelle. In her podcast “The Work Brunch” she regularly combines musical and culinary topics. Her last album, Tantil Before I Breathe (2017), came with a cookbook. Otherwise, the past ten years have been pretty quiet for the British rapper, who recorded two wonderfully committed and playful hip-hop records, “Speech Therapy” (2009) and “Freedom Of Speech” (2012).

A food truck with spicy curry and good wine, soul and social criticism, sunny pop sounds and enthusiastic R&B

“Sunday Dinner On A Monday” is now a food truck with spicy curry and good wine, soul and social criticism, sunny pop sounds (“Come Your Way”), trippy electronics (“101010”) and rapturous R&B (“Atlantis”).
